And atl server projects are actually visual c types , but are included here because the debugging techniques used with them have more in common with web applications “ atl server web服務(wù)”和“ atl server項目”這兩種項目類型實際上是visual c + +類型,包含在此的原因是它們使用的調(diào)試技術(shù)與web應(yīng)用程序有著更多共同之處。
Links you to debugging techniques for atl projects , including : debugging queryinterface calls , tracking reference counts , debugging and error reporting in global functions , and debugging and error reporting in macros 鏈接到atl項目的調(diào)試技術(shù),包括:調(diào)試queryinterface調(diào)用、跟蹤引用數(shù)、調(diào)試和錯誤報告全局函數(shù)以及調(diào)試和錯誤報告宏。
Links you to debugging techniques for the c run - time library , including using the crt debug library , macros for reporting , differences between malloc and malloc dbg , writing debug hook functions , and the crt debug heap 鏈接到用于c運行時庫的調(diào)試技術(shù),包括:使用crt調(diào)試庫、用于報告的宏、 malloc和_ malloc _ dbg之間的差異、編寫調(diào)試掛鉤函數(shù)以及crt調(diào)試堆。
Now that you have added the use of error reporting , print statements , phpeclipse , and the debugger extension to your arsenal of debugging techniques in php , you will become a more effective php coder by reducing the number of errors you create per line of code 現(xiàn)在已經(jīng)向php的調(diào)試技術(shù)集中添加了錯誤報告的運用、 print語句、 phpeclipse和調(diào)試器擴(kuò)展,您可以通過減少每行代碼的錯誤數(shù)量,成為更有效的php編碼人員。
As a crucial embedded development tool , the embedded system debugger is usually used to debug and test embedded software 。 a embedded system debugger consists of a cross debugger and a debugger agent , which characteristic lies in the separation of running environments between the cross debugger and the debuggee and the dependence on the gdb agent in the debug session 。 with the development of embedded technique , various embedded debug techniques continuously advance and all kinds of embedded system debuggers are playing a more and more important role in the embedded software development 。 the gnu debugger , gdb as a tool in the gnu toolkits , is an extremely powerful source - level debugger 。 among gdb ’ s many noteworthy features , its ability to debug programs “ remote ” is fascinating 。 this capability is not only essential when porting gnu tools to a new operation system or microprocessor , but it ’ s also useful for developers who need to debug an embedded system based on a processor that gnu already supports 。 gdb is the preferred solution in embedded development because it provides portable , sophisticated debugging over a broad rang of embedded systems 。 this paper discusses the status quo of various embedded system debuggers ; deeply analyses the overall structure of gdb and the debugging mechanism of gdb based on its source codes ; introduces the gdb ’ s remote debug technique and gdb / mi , which are usually used to develop the gdb - based embedded system debugger 。 then dwells on how to use gdb / mi to develop a gui front and how to use rsp 、 stub and gdbserver to design a debug agent , in order to expatiate on the design method of the gdb - based embedded system debugger 。 in the end , provides a concrete implementation of the gdb - based embedded system debugger of “ embedded simulation development platform ” , the project of the innovation fund for technology based firms 。 這個特性不僅在將gnu工具移植到一個新的操作系統(tǒng)和微處理器的時候很有用,對于想調(diào)試一個基于gnu支持的芯片的嵌入式系統(tǒng)的開發(fā)人員來說,也是非常有用的。由于gdb提供了在大多數(shù)嵌入式系統(tǒng)上的可移植的、復(fù)雜的調(diào)試功能,它已成為嵌入式開發(fā)的首選解決方案。本文討論了當(dāng)前的各種嵌入式調(diào)試器的現(xiàn)狀,結(jié)合源代碼詳細(xì)分析了gdb的結(jié)構(gòu)和調(diào)試原理,介紹了開發(fā)基于gdb的嵌入式系統(tǒng)調(diào)試器常用的遠(yuǎn)程調(diào)試技術(shù)和gdb / mi接口;然后詳細(xì)闡述了如何使用gdb / mi開發(fā)gdb的圖形前端和怎樣使用rsp協(xié)議、 stub和gdbserver設(shè)計一個調(diào)試代理,從而較深入地討論了基于gdb的嵌入式調(diào)試器的設(shè)計方法;最后,結(jié)合國家中小型企業(yè)創(chuàng)新基金項目“嵌入式仿真開發(fā)平臺” ,給出了一個基于gdb的嵌入式系統(tǒng)調(diào)試器具體實現(xiàn)。
The influence curve of the two flexible connector hinges ’ relative position is achieved by analyzing the model with the pseudo - rigid - body model . it has been found out that the rigidity variety of the model requires an assembly application with high coaxiality and orthogonality , which should supervises the whole assemblage and debugging technique 通過影響曲線的分析,給出了內(nèi)外接頭鉸鏈方位偏差對十字鉸鏈模型剛度的影響程度,而模型剛度變化則對整個陀螺的裝配精度提出了同軸和正交的要求,對整個陀螺儀的裝配和調(diào)試起到了指導(dǎo)作用。